The dashboard only updates around the 10th of each month. You will have no data in the dashboard until the 10th of next month.

The active rewards circle also does not work correctly in month 1 on the app. You should however still be getting the active rewards weekly if you make the 100km event free distance. It should update to "Achieved" on Saturday late afternoon (at the latest) on the app if you made the 100km event free trip even though the circle did not move

It takes about 3 months for your drive history to build up and for Discovery to accurately allocate you drive points.

Not that sure how Smartshopper points work, but remember reading, when PnP changed the T&C a while back, that you get R10 back for 1000 smartshopper points. Is that still the case, and does it work differently with Tymebank ?

I don't buy a lot of Healthyfood items, but get about R400 back per month on this (25% of total spend), which goes up to R 800 with the difference (extra R400) coming from the bank (another 25% of total spend).

Using the R10 / 1000 smartshopper points conversion rate that is 80,000 points needed to get the same R 800 back. How much do you need to spend to get 80,000 points ?
